胃癌组织中COX-2和VEGF表达及其相关性研究 被引量:10

Expressions and correlation of COX-2 and VEGF in gastric carcinoma.

摘要 目的探讨环氧合酶2(cyclooxygenase-2,COX-2)和血管内皮生长因子(vascularendothelial growthfactor,VEGF)在人胃癌组织中表达及其相关性。方法应用免疫组织化学SABC法检测53例人胃癌组织中COX-2、VEGF和CD34的表达,并以40例正常胃粘膜标本作为对照。对CD34阳性血管进行微血管密度(microvesseldensity,MVD)计数。对COX-2和VEGF的表达采用半定量计分法判定,并结合临床资料进行统计学分析。结果53例人胃癌组织中,COX-2表达阳性者44例,阳性率为83.0%;VEGF表达阳性者45例,阳性率为84.9%。COX-2表达与VEGF表达相关显著(P<0.05)。并且,COX-2和VEGF的表达与TNM分期(P<0.05,P<0.05)、淋巴结转移(P<0.01,P<0.05)和远处转移(P<0.01,P<0.05)相关。COX-2/VEGF同高表达组中MVD值(79.5±25.8)高于COX-2/VEGF同低表达组中的MVD值(45.0±13.9),差异非常显著(P<0.01)。结论胃癌组织中COX-2与VEGF共表达,并相互协同促进肿瘤血管生成和转移。 Objective To study the expressions of cyclooxygenase-2 (COX-2) and vascular endothelial growth factor (VEGF) in gastric cancer and to explore their correlation in gastric carcinoma. Methods The expressions of COX-2 and VEGF were studied by immunohistochemistry in 53 gastric cancer specimens and 40 normal tissues as control. The microvessel density (MVD) was assayed by CD34 positive blood vessels counting. Results Expressions of COX-2 and VEGF in gastric cancer tissues were 83.0% and 84.9% respectively. The expression of COX-2 was correlated significantly with VEGF expression (P< 0.05). Expressions of COX-2 and VEGF were highly correlated with TNM stage(P< 0.05,P< 0.05) ,lymph node metastasis(P< 0.01, P< 0.05) and distant metastasis (P< 0.01, P< 0.05). The MVD value was much higher in COX-2/VEGF double strong expression group than that in COX-2/VEGF double weak expression group (P< 0.01). Conclusion COX-2 overexpression is remarkably correlated with that of VEGF and they may play an important role in tumor angiogenesis and metastasis of human gastric cancer.
